Quote from: frequency9 on June 22, 2013, 02:14:29 PM
Does anyone know how to access the extra channels - will I need a second receiver connected to the Rx smartport or what?? (?)

Basically, I will be wanting channels for the following: 1 ch E, 1 ch A, 1 ch R, 1 ch T, 2 ch Flaps, 2 ch pan and tilt, 1 ch Camera control, 1 ch osd control, 1 ch RTH and PA / stabilization. That makes 11 channels of in-plane functions - if I counted right! :-[

How will I be able to do this using the Taranis, and which Rx(s) and or extra bits will I require???

Up until now I've been using a 9X with Frsky module and  FrSky D8R-II Plus Rx, with 4 chs for RETA, 1 ch Flaps, 2 Chs pan and tilt, 1 ch stabilizer.

you can either run the X8r got 8 traditional output and a 16ch Sbus output - frsky is selling a 4ch sbus decoder that plugs into the sbus port and gives you another 4 pwm outs. That means you have 12 channels to play with

or you can use 2 X8R recievers for 16 channels pwm.
